HR Compliance Officer
HR Compliance Officer (Education and Children s Residential Care) Hybrid: 2/3 days per week in the Leeds office About the Role The HR Compliance Officer ensures that the organization meets all safer recruitment, HR regulatory, and safeguarding compliance requirements across education settings, children s residential homes and supported accommodation. The role oversees DBS checks, payroll compliance and leavers reference to ensure all staff meet the standards of OFSTED and follow KCSIE guidance. Key Responsibilities: DBS Management (Enhanced and Barred Lists) Manage enhanced DBS checks for all staff working in Education, Residential, Supported Accommodation. Ensure timely renewal cycles and maintain accurate DBS status tracking. Conduct identity verification and oversee the accuracy of DBS submissions. Review returned disclosures and coordinate risk assessments where necessary. Keep our SAGE People system up to date with DBS information Employment Referencing Complete employment references received on behalf of the company for all ex Horizon colleagues inline with Keeping Children Safe in Education. Ensure that the references are completed accurately and in a timely manner. Payroll Compliance Support Ensure payroll changes comply with employment law, sector regulations, and organisational policy on Sage People.
